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7565797250 99408459035 15904036 7695179314 51
9555 869176 6073601464
9555 869176 6073601464
63 22874898604 2478 83580373091
All about undefined
Interested in learning more?
9555 869176 6073601464
63 22874898604 2478 83580373091
See more
73960131701 71 629972112
35 34270740543 327
See more
047189827 37 1920836447
63 501781123 0820869
See more